Description

In 480BC, at a bleak pass in a far-flung corner of eastern Greece, 300 Spartans faced the army of Xerxes of Persia, a massive force rumored to be over a million strong while their orders were simple: to delay the enemy for as long as possible while the main Greek armies mobilized.

For six days the Spartans held the invaders at bay. In the final hours - their shields broken, swords and spears shattered - they fought with their bare hands before being overwhelmed. It was a battle that would become synonymous with extraordinary courage, heroism, and self-sacrifice: it is Thermopylae.  

In Gates of Fire, Steven Pressfield tells the epic story of those legendary Spartans: the men and women who helped shaped our history and have themselves become immortal.

The Power of Unity

In Gates of Fire, Steven Pressfield emphasizes the importance of unity and brotherhood. The Spartan soldiers stand together, not just as a military unit, but as a family. This unity gives them strength and resilience in the face of adversity. It's a great reminder for us to value the relationships we have and to stand together with those we care about.

Courage in the Face of Fear

Pressfield's book shows us that true courage is not the absence of fear, but the ability to face it head-on. The Spartan warriors in the story are not fearless, but they do not let their fear control them. This is a powerful lesson for anyone who's ever felt afraid - it's okay to be scared, what matters is how you respond to that fear.

The Importance of Discipline

In Gates of Fire, discipline is a key theme. The Spartan warriors are rigorously trained and their strict discipline is what allows them to excel in battle. This book encourages us to apply the same principle in our lives. Whether it's sticking to a workout routine or staying focused on a project, discipline can lead to great achievements.

Sacrifice for the Greater Good

The book explores the concept of sacrifice for the greater good. The Spartans are willing to give up their lives for the sake of their city and their comrades. This selflessness is a powerful message about the importance of thinking beyond our own needs and considering the bigger picture.

The Human Spirit's Resilience

Gates of Fire is a testament to the resilience of the human spirit. Despite facing overwhelming odds, the Spartans refuse to give up. This resilience is something we can all learn from. No matter how tough things get, we have the ability to keep going and to overcome our challenges.
